Anyone had a fault where the boiler seems to get stuck in pump overrun, fire and go out ( then stay in pump over run for 5 mins) etc before? Had 240v on the pump but it wasn't running, swapped pump even though the fault had nothing to do with a pump running but still playing up.

ext. controls are fine, 240v across lr & ls continuously, but boiler seems to forget the heating is being called for, then wake up for a few seconds, fire, then go out and into pump over run, then eventually fire and run ok?... Very odd. I thought I'd seen it all with these but they never fail to amaze me with how many ways they can break.

must be a board fault but could do with confirmation if poss.

Had roughly the same fault last night but that went to lock out after firing, linked out the over heat and it ran a treat, clean system, no rippled hex so i doubt its blocked and not clearing the heat.

replacing it the overheat stat tomorrow night and will see.

dubious to see if it it the stat, but at 7 quid i don't mind having a spare 🙂
 
It's a common ish fault ,the one on top of kebab?

From memory two thermisters on top of tinned kebab and one other , they are fairly regular spares along with fans.
